It's not the enforced closure of the line (although I fail to see how
installing a set of points and associated tunnel branching can take all of

18
months)


I wondered this too, given that similar jobs for the Victoria and Jubilee
lines were done with closures lasting no more than a few hours. However, I
understand that there are major problems with water at the site of the T5
junction, and for this reason a quite complex engineering solution is
required.
